您的位置 主页 正文

java导入数据库并校验

一、java导入数据库并校验 随着互联网的发展,越来越多的企业和个人开始关注网站优化的重要性。而作为一名资深网站管理员,了解搜索引擎优化(SEO)的基本原理和方法是至关重要

一、java导入数据库并校验

随着互联网的发展,越来越多的企业和个人开始关注网站优化的重要性。而作为一名资深网站管理员,了解搜索引擎优化(SEO)的基本原理和方法是至关重要的。今天,我们将重点讨论如何利用java导入数据库并校验的技术来优化网站内容,提升排名和流量。

什么是java导入数据库并校验

在网站开发过程中,经常会涉及到数据的导入和校验工作。而java作为一种常用的编程语言,在处理数据导入和校验方面有着很好的表现。利用java技术,可以实现从各种数据源中导入数据到数据库,并进行必要的校验,确保数据的完整性和正确性。

数据的导入过程一般分为数据读取、数据处理和数据写入三个步骤。而数据校验则是在数据写入数据库前进行的一系列判断和验证操作,以确保数据的合法性和准确性。

java导入数据库并校验的优势

相比其他编程语言,利用java进行数据导入和校验有着诸多优势。首先,java具有丰富的类库和框架,可以大大简化开发工作,提高效率。其次,java语言本身具有良好的跨平台性,可以在不同的操作系统和环境中稳定运行。此外,java的强类型系统和异常处理机制也使得数据处理更加可靠。

另外,利用java进行数据导入和校验还能够实现灵活定制的功能需求。开发人员可以根据实际情况,结合java的特性,实现各种复杂的数据处理和校验逻辑,满足不同场景下的需求。

如何利用java导入数据库并校验优化网站

在网站优化过程中,合理地利用java导入数据库并校验的技术,可以为网站带来诸多好处。首先,通过有效的数据导入和校验,可以提升网站的内容质量和完整性,为用户提供更好的浏览体验。其次,及时进行数据校验和处理,可以避免因数据错误导致的网站故障和用户投诉。

此外,利用java技术进行数据导入和校验还能够提升网站在搜索引擎中的排名。搜索引擎通常会更青睐内容质量高、完整性强的网站,而通过java技术实现的数据导入和校验能够有效提升网站内容的质量,从而提升排名和流量。

总结

综上所述,利用java导入数据库并校验的技术优化网站是一种行之有效的方法。通过合理利用java的强大功能和灵活性,可以实现高效的数据处理和校验,提升网站内容质量,同时提高排名和流量。因此,在网站优化工作中,开发人员应该充分发挥java技术的优势,为网站的发展注入新动力。

二、java中如何将json数据导入sqlserver数据库?

如果是把json中的数据字段和数据库字段一一对应的话,你可以jack son或fastjson这样的第三方jar来解析完成对应关系,从而导入数据库。

三、轻松实现Java导入Excel数据到数据库的完整指南

引言

在当今的数据驱动时代,企业和开发者面临着高效管理数据的挑战。将数据从Excel表格导入到数据库中是常见的需求,尤其是在处理大量数据时。本篇文章将详细介绍如何使用Java来实现Excel到数据库的导入过程,涵盖所需的工具、步骤和代码示例。

为什么选择Java进行数据导入?

Java是一种平台无关的编程语言,具有出色的性能和强大的库支持。在进行Excel到数据库的导入时,Java的优势主要体现在以下几个方面:

  • 跨平台支持: Java可以在不同操作系统上运行,方便漏洞的迁移。
  • 丰富的库: Java拥有许多开源库可供使用,如Apache POI和JExcel,用于读取和处理Excel文件。
  • 高效的数据处理: Java可轻松处理大规模数据,提供了良好的性能和内存管理。

所需工具和库

为了实现Excel到数据库的导入,需要以下工具和库:

  • Java Development Kit (JDK): 确保安装了JDK环境,推荐使用Java 8或以上版本。
  • Apache POI: 一个用于操作Microsoft Excel文档的Java库。可以通过Maven依赖引入:
  • 
    
        org.apache.poi
        poi
        5.2.3
    
    
        org.apache.poi
        poi-ooxml
        5.2.3
    
    
        
  • JDBC: Java数据库连接的工具,便于与数据库交互。

步骤概述

将Excel数据导入数据库的过程可以分为以下几个主要步骤:

  • 1. 读取Excel文件。
  • 2. 处理Excel数据。
  • 3. 建立与数据库的连接。
  • 4. 将数据插入到数据库中。

详细步骤

1. 读取Excel文件

使用Apache POI库,可以轻松读取Excel文件的数据。下面是一个示例代码:


import org.apache.poi.ss.usermodel.*;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;

import java.io.File;
import java.io.FileInputStream;
import java.io.IOException;

public class ReadExcel {
    public static void main(String[] args) {
        String excelFilePath = "path_to_your_file.xlsx"; // Excel文件路径
        try (FileInputStream fis = new FileInputStream(new File(excelFilePath));
             Workbook workbook = new XSSFWorkbook(fis)) {
            Sheet sheet = workbook.getSheetAt(0); // 读取第一个工作表
            for (Row row : sheet) {
                for (Cell cell : row) {
                    System.out.print(cell.toString() + "\t"); // 输出单元格内容
                }
                System.out.println();
            }
        } catch (IOException e) {
            e.printStackTrace();
        }
    }
}

  

2. 处理Excel数据

在读取Excel数据后,您可能需要对数据进行一些处理,比如去除空值或格式化数据。以下是一个简单的示例:


for (Row row : sheet) {
    if (row.getRowNum() == 0) continue; // 跳过表头
    String name = row.getCell(0).getStringCellValue(); // 获取第一列数据
    double score = row.getCell(1).getNumericCellValue(); // 获取第二列数据
    // 进行数据处理操作
}

  

3. 建立与数据库的连接

使用JDBC来连接数据库。以下是与数据库建立连接的示例:


import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;

public class DatabaseConnection {
    public static void main(String[] args) {
        String url = "jdbc:mysql://localhost:3306/your_database"; // 数据库URL
        String user = "root"; // 数据库用户名
        String password = "your_password"; // 数据库密码
        try {
            Connection connection = DriverManager.getConnection(url, user, password);
            System.out.println("Connection established");
        } catch (SQLException e) {
            e.printStackTrace();
        }
    }
}

  

4. 将数据插入到数据库

在读取并处理Excel数据后,可以使用PreparedStatement将数据插入数据库中。以下是一个示例:


import java.sql.PreparedStatement;

for (Row row : sheet) {
    if (row.getRowNum() == 0) continue; // 跳过表头
    String name = row.getCell(0).getStringCellValue();
    double score = row.getCell(1).getNumericCellValue();

    String sql = "INSERT INTO students (name, score) VALUES (?, ?)";
    try (PreparedStatement pstmt = connection.prepareStatement(sql)) {
        pstmt.setString(1, name);
        pstmt.setDouble(2, score);
        pstmt.executeUpdate();
    }
}

  

总结

通过以上步骤,我们清晰地了解了如何使用JavaExcel数据导入到数据库。总结一下,整个流程如下:

  • 使用Apache POI读取Excel文件。
  • 处理数据以确保其格式正确。
  • 通过JDBC建立与数据库的连接。
  • 使用PreparedStatement将数据插入数据库。

希望通过这篇文章,能够帮助您更有效地完成数据的导入工作。感谢您阅读这篇文章,期待它能够在您的项目中提供实用的指导和帮助。

四、数据库怎么导入数据,数据库怎么导入表?

1>.采用InnoDB存储引擎;

2>.设置innodb_buffer_pool_size较大的值,且设置脏数据:innodb_max_dirty_pages_pct=95;

3>.关闭log-bin 日志;

4>.设置sort_buffer_pool_size的值稍微大一点;

5>.使用多表空间:innodb_file_per_table;

6>.innodb_flush_log_at_trx_commit=0 且sync_binlog=0;

7>.多个mysql客户端同时导入数据库备份文件,后台执行就是;

五、phpstudy如何到导入数据库?

点击MySQL管理器--》点击进入MySQL-Front--》在localhost下选择新建一个数据库--》点击新建数据库后,在对象浏览器窗口,单击右键--》输入--》sql文件命令,进入后选择对应.sql文件进行导入(注意:字符集格式选择)

六、怎从java中导入数据库

怎从java中导入数据库

数据库是Web开发中至关重要的组成部分,通过Java连接数据库是实现数据存取的常用方式之一。本文将介绍如何从Java程序中导入数据库,以及一些常见的注意事项和最佳实践。

1. JDBC驱动程序

Java连接数据库的主要方式是使用JDBC(Java Database Connectivity)。JDBC是Java用于执行SQL语句的标准API,为不同的数据库提供了统一的访问方法。在开始使用JDBC之前,您需要确保已经安装并配置了相应数据库的JDBC驱动程序。

2. 导入数据库的步骤

要在Java中导入数据库,您需要按照以下步骤操作:

  • 1. 加载数据库驱动程序:使用Class类的forName方法加载数据库的JDBC驱动程序。
  • 2. 建立数据库连接:使用DriverManager类的getConnection方法建立与数据库的连接。
  • 3. 创建和执行SQL语句:通过Connection对象创建Statement或PreparedStatement对象,执行SQL语句。
  • 4. 处理结果集:如果需要,通过ResultSet对象处理SQL查询返回的结果。
  • 5. 关闭连接:最后,记得手动关闭数据库连接,释放资源。

3. JDBC示例代码

下面是一个简单的Java程序示例,演示如何从Java中连接和操作数据库:

import java.sql.Connection; import java.sql.DriverManager; import java.sql.Statement; public class DatabaseExample { public static void main(String[] args) { try { Class.forName("com.mysql.cj.jdbc.Driver"); String url = "jdbc:mysql://localhost:3306/mydatabase"; Connection conn = DriverManager.getConnection(url, "username", "password"); Statement stmt = conn.createStatement(); String sql = "SELECT * FROM users"; ResultSet rs = stmt.executeQuery(sql); while (rs.next()) { // Process the result set } conn.close(); } catch (Exception e) { e.printStackTrace(); } } }

4. 注意事项

在使用Java连接数据库时,以下是一些需要注意的事项:

  • 1. 避免使用硬编码的数据库连接信息,可以将连接信息配置在外部文件中,提高安全性。
  • 2. 使用PreparedStatement防止SQL注入攻击,不要直接拼接SQL语句。
  • 3. 及时关闭数据库连接,释放资源,防止资源泄露。
  • 4. 使用连接池提高数据库访问性能,避免频繁创建和销毁连接。
  • 5. 处理异常情况,编写健壮的代码,确保程序稳定性。

5. 总结

通过本文的介绍,您应该了解了如何从Java中导入数据库,并掌握了一些相关的注意事项和最佳实践。在实际开发中,合理地利用JDBC API可以帮助您高效地与数据库进行交互,从而实现Web应用程序的数据存取功能。

七、如何使用Java导入MySQL数据库?

引言

在开发Java应用程序时,经常需要将数据存储到MySQL数据库中。本文将介绍如何使用Java编写程序,以及通过程序将数据导入到MySQL数据库中。

准备工作

首先,确保你的系统已经安装了Java开发工具包(JDK)和MySQL数据库。你需要在你的Java项目中导入MySQL连接器(Connector)/驱动器,以便Java程序能够连接和操作MySQL数据库。

编写Java程序

使用Java编写程序来导入数据到MySQL数据库需要遵循以下步骤:

  1. 连接到数据库:在Java程序中,首先需要建立与MySQL数据库的连接。使用JDBC来实现,加载MySQL驱动器,创建连接并获取数据库连接对象。
  2. 准备SQL语句:接下来,准备SQL语句用于向数据库中插入数据。使用PreparedStatement或Statement对象来执行SQL语句。
  3. 插入数据:将数据插入到MySQL数据库中,通过执行SQL语句完成数据导入操作。
  4. 关闭连接:最后,记得关闭数据库连接以释放资源,防止资源泄露。

示例代码

下面是一个简单的Java程序示例,演示了如何将数据导入到MySQL数据库:

  
  import java.sql.Connection;
  import java.sql.DriverManager;
  import java.sql.PreparedStatement;
  
  public class Main {
    public static void main(String[] args) {
       String url = "jdbc:mysql://localhost:3306/yourDB";
       String user = "username";
       String password = "password";
       
       try {
          Connection connection = DriverManager.getConnection(url, user, password);
          String query = "INSERT INTO yourTable (column1, column2, column3) VALUES (?, ?, ?)";
          PreparedStatement statement = connection.prepareStatement(query);
          statement.setString(1, "value1");
          statement.setString(2, "value2");
          statement.setString(3, "value3");
          statement.executeUpdate();
          connection.close();
       } catch (Exception e) {
          e.printStackTrace();
       }
    }
  }
  
  

总结

通过编写Java程序,连接到MySQL数据库并执行SQL语句,可以轻松实现数据的导入操作。这种方法非常灵活,适用于各种不同类型的数据导入需求。

感谢您阅读本文,希望本文能够帮助您更好地理解如何使用Java导入MySQL数据库。

八、Sqlyog怎么导入本地数据到数据库?

要将本地数据导入到 MySQL 数据库,可以按照以下步骤使用 Sqlyog:

1. 打开 Sqlyog,连接到要导入数据的目标数据库;

2. 在菜单栏中选择“导入”,弹出导入向导;

3. 在“源文件”中选择要导入的文件;

4. 在“目标表”中选择要导入数据的目标表;

5. 在“拆分方式”中选择“按行拆分”或“按列拆分”;

6. 在“选项”中可以设置导入的字符集、去除留空格、是否跳过错误等选项;

7. 点击“导入”开始导入数据。

注意事项:

1. 要保证源文件的格式与目标表的结构匹配;

2. 如果要导入的数据较多,可以选择分批导入;

3. 在导入数据时需要注意数据的完整性和有效性,避免出现数据丢失或错误的情况。

希望这些步骤能够帮助您将本地数据成功导入到 MySQL 数据库中。

九、数据库怎么导入数据?

数据库的数据导入可以通过以下步骤完成:

1. 打开数据库管理工具,例如MySQL Workbench、Navicat等。

2. 创建一个数据库或者选择一个已有的数据库。

3. 在工具中找到导入数据的选项,通常可以在“文件”或“工具”菜单中找到。

4. 选择要导入的数据文件,通常支持多种格式的文件,例如CSV、SQL、Excel等。

5. 配置导入选项,例如数据表、字段映射、字符编码等。

6. 开始导入数据,等待导入完成。

7. 验证导入结果,可以通过查询数据库来确认数据是否已经成功导入。

请注意,不同的数据库管理工具可能有不同的界面和操作方式,以上步骤仅供参考。同时,导入数据需要谨慎操作,特别是在生产环境中,请务必备份数据并进行测试。

十、如何快速导入数据到MySQL数据库

背景

在进行数据分析、数据处理或开发时,我们经常需要将数据导入到MySQL数据库中。数据导入MySQL数据库的过程可能会比较繁琐,特别是当数据量较大时。在本文中,我们将介绍一些快速而有效的方法来导入数据到MySQL数据库。

1. 使用命令行工具

MySQL提供了命令行工具来导入数据,这是最常用且高效的方法之一。您可以使用以下命令导入一个包含数据的.sql文件:

mysql -u 用户名 -p 密码 数据库名 < 文件路径

您需要将上述命令中的"用户名"、"密码"、"数据库名"和"文件路径"替换成您自己的实际信息。

此外,您还可以使用导入命令时的一些选项来优化导入过程,例如使用"--ignore"选项忽略重复记录。

2. 使用MySQL Workbench

MySQL Workbench是MySQL官方提供的一款图形化界面工具,它提供了方便的界面来管理和操作MySQL数据库。您可以通过以下步骤在MySQL Workbench中导入数据:

  1. 打开MySQL Workbench并连接到您的MySQL服务器。
  2. 在导航菜单中选择"Server",然后选择"Data Import"。
  3. 选择要导入的数据源和目标数据库。
  4. 选择要导入的数据文件,并配置导入选项。
  5. 点击"Start Import"开始导入数据。

使用MySQL Workbench导入数据可以更加直观和可视化,特别适合对数据库有较少了解的用户。

3. 使用DataGrip

DataGrip是一款由JetBrains开发的强大的多数据库管理工具。它支持多种数据库,包括MySQL。您可以通过以下步骤在DataGrip中导入数据:

  1. 打开DataGrip并连接到您的MySQL服务器。
  2. 在"Database"面板中选择目标数据库,然后右键单击该数据库。
  3. 选择"Import Data"。
  4. 选择要导入的数据文件并配置导入选项。
  5. 点击"Import"开始导入数据。

DataGrip提供了更多高级功能和定制选项,适合专业开发人员和数据库管理员使用。

4. 使用编程语言和MySQL驱动

如果您是开发人员,您也可以使用编程语言(如Python、Java等)配合MySQL驱动来导入数据。不同的编程语言和驱动库提供了各自的API和方法来操作MySQL数据库。您可以根据具体的编程语言和驱动文档来编写导入数据的代码。

总结

无论您是使用命令行工具、MySQL Workbench、DataGrip还是编程语言,导入数据到MySQL数据库都是非常常见和重要的任务。根据您的具体需求和个人偏好,选择适合自己的方法来导入数据。希望本文能够帮助您快速、高效地导入数据到MySQL数据库。

感谢您的阅读!

为您推荐

返回顶部